How To Increase Website Traffic Using Forum Posting

Increasing website traffic can be a difficult business for many site owners. You may need some techniques to advertise your site and attract web users to visit it. One way to do it is by forum posting. Forum posting can be of great help to your website if you can use it well. Here are some tips on how to increase your website’s traffic by posting on various online forums:

* Choose a forum with high traffic. So as not to waste your efforts and to maximize results, you need to find a forum which is worth posting. These forums have to be frequently visited as well. A million views per month rate is enough traffic for the forum to be ideal.
* Choose a forum that caters to your interest. Going to the playing field armed with your interest offers more reassurance that you would be able to post decent and valuable contents on the forum. Plus your knowledge on the matter will allow you to create very relevant messages. Web users will appreciate that. It also has to be connected with the website that you want to link.
* Be extra careful with the contents of your post. It has to be really connected and contributing to what the forum is asking for. You have to sound real and sincere when you are telling something about your site. Refrain from posting irrelevant and out-of-topic contents, if you don’t want the forum owner to label your contents as spam. If these situations happen a lot, your account might be suspended.
* Create a signature and make your presence felt. Your signature is the message just before your posting ends. This will direct the readers to your site. You may hyperlink words that will allow them to recognize what you are offering on your site. You should try several phrases for signature, and find out which one attracts most web users. Your signature is composed of words which will stir other forum members into action. That is, to click on your site.

* Build a reputable presence in the forum site. It is important for you to earn the respect and trust of the forum members. You must cater to their needs and not to bombard them with requests of visiting your website. This might even make them do otherwise. Instead, build a symbiotic relationship wherein you are also allowed to ask your own questions and research on ways to help back those who have answered yours. It is wrong to post a thread and not come back to check on it. You should follow up your appearances and let them know that you are a consistent active member of the forum. Your activity in the forum site will allow your presence to be felt. When your presence is recognized, it will be the start of generating traffic for your site.
* Go for a more personal touch. Instead of leaving posts under funny and anonymously written pen names, try using your real name with a real photo of you. People are more inclined to believing you and taking your offer if they can actually tell who you are.


Generating traffic for your website needs a lot of ground work on your part. You must have patience, knowledge and a lot of strategic moves up your sleeves.
